Why Consider Replacing Your Windows and Doors?
Improved Energy Efficiency
Older doors and windows are frequently poorly insulated, enabling air to get away or go into, which can lead to greater heating and cooling bills. Modern replacement windows and doors are developed with energy efficiency in mind. Features such as double or triple-pane glass, Low-E finishes, and insulated frames help to reduce heat transfer, keeping your home warm in winter and cool in summer. By decreasing energy loss, these updates can decrease your monthly energy expenses and minimize your carbon footprint.

Signs You Need Replacement Windows and Doors
How do you know when it's time to change your windows and doors? Watch out for  similar resource site :


Drafts and Air Leaks: If you can feel drafts even when windows and doors are closed, it's a sign they're no longer sealing properly.
Trouble Operating: Sticking, warping, or trouble opening and closing are signs of wear.
Condensation and Fogging: Moisture accumulation in between glass panes shows that the seal has actually failed.
Rotting or Damage: Visible decay or physical damage to the frames can compromise functionality and appearance.
High Energy Bills: Rising energy costs might be an idea that your windows and doors aren't insulating your home properly.
Selecting the Right Replacement Materials
When choosing replacement doors and windows, it's important to consider the material as much as the style. Here are the most popular choices:

Vinyl: Affordable, durable, and energy-efficient, vinyl is a typical option that needs very little maintenance.
Wood: Ideal for standard charm, wood windows and doors supply a timeless look however may need periodic upkeep to prevent rot and wear.
Aluminum: Lightweight and strong, aluminum is fantastic for large or modern-day styles however might not use the very same level of insulation as other materials.
Fiberglass: Known for resilience and effectiveness, fiberglass can imitate wood without the requirement for maintenance.
